Karrion Kross' Contract Reportedly Expires Very Soon

Karrion Kross could be on his way out soon.

According to Fightful’s Sean Ross Sapp, Kross’ WWE contract expires sometime this summer. The report states that neither party has started the negotiation process, but WWE’s has been impressed with the former NXT Champion in recent months. With the way Kross has been able to get himself over on social media and his backstage segments, it does sound like the company plans on keeping the 39-year-old. However, that’s last part is pure speculation as Sapp’s report never states clearly that officials are keen on keeping the RAW Superstar. 

Kross has had only one match in 2025. That’s a random bout against Akira Tozawa on Main Event (Yep, that still exists). However, Kross has been a crucial piece to several storylines such as The New Day’s recent heel turn, AJ Styles, and Sami Zayn. 

Styles is facing Logan Paul at WrestleMania 41 so a potential match between them is off the table. There’s some possibility that Sami Zayn vs. Karrion Kross could happen at WrestleMania, but that’s also a slim chance since the former Intercontinental Champion hasn’t been seen during the WrestleMania season. 

Despite the lack of action, Kross is really clicking as a character at the moment. It would be surprising if Kross left WWE, though he has high name value so he’ll be fine should that happen. In terms of his wife Scarlett, it’s not clear if her contract expires this summer as well. 

Though Scarlett wrestles regularly on live events, she’s only had two official matches in WWE and those were mixed tag team matches with her husband. It’s strange that Scarlett isn’t used more as a wrestler as she was primarily a wrestler before joining WWE.

Both Karrion and Scarlett made their returns in 2022. Kross came back and immediately feuded with Drew McIntyre. Once that feud fizzled out, Kross mainly floated around the mid-card scene. He briefly had an alliance with The Authors of Pain and that faction even handed The Wyatt Sicks their first loss, but Akam and Rezar were released from their contracts back in February.

Though Karrion originally teased a world title feud with Roman Reigns upon his return, he’s yet to challenge for any of the major belts on the main roster. There’s no word on when WWE and Kross plan on starting the negotiation process. The company is currently focused on WrestleMania, so it likely won’t happen until after the big PLE.
